I used it off and on for about 20 years, then it went to a cousin. It came back about three years ago. Speaker was replaced with a Jensen, but I also have the old speaker that needs new paper put on. I replaced all the electrolytic capacitors a few years ago. It seems to run a little hotter now, but still works well. I worry about burning out the transformer. Not sure where one could be found or how to best find a replacement. Losing the transformer may be the end if that happens. Somehow in the transfers, the foot switch for the reverb was lost. Can't seem to find one. I also have a schematic that was posted long ago. Not sure how to post it here. The loss of power in the unit listed could be a number of things. A good electronics tech can fix it unless it has a problem in the transformer.Anonymousnore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-5906814047068760205.post-13801251264593376092010-10-09T06:22:14.229-07:002010-10-09T06:22:14.229-07:00This post on vintage amp forum has same pictures a...This post on vintage amp forum has same pictures and describes amp malfunctioning after 30 minutes (thread also has a schematic). <br />http://www.vintageamps.com/plexiboard/viewtopic.php?f=11&t=89556&start=15#p914235<br /><br />This amp has a nice review on harmony central.Anonymousnoreply@blogger.com
